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Chicken Road Game
At its heart, the chicken road game relies on two primary mechanics: timing and avoidance. Players tap the screen to make the chicken jump, aiming to clear the oncoming vehicles. Precisely timing these jumps is crucial for survival. A mistimed jump means certain disaster, as the chicken will be flattened by the relentless traffic. The speed of the vehicles and their frequency increase as the game progresses, making successful navigation increasingly difficult.
Furthermore, the inclusion of collectable coins introduces a layer of strategic decision-making. Do you risk a jump to collect a coin, potentially endangering the chicken, or do you focus solely on avoiding the traffic? This choice adds depth to the gameplay and rewards skillful players. Mastering both the timing of jumps and the optimization of coin collection is the key to achieving a high score.

Strategies for Maximizing Your Score
Becoming adept at the chicken road game isn’t just about luck; it’s about learning and applying effective strategies. One crucial tactic is observing the patterns of the traffic. While the game appears random, there’s often a rhythm to the flow of vehicles. Recognizing these patterns allows players to anticipate gaps and time their jumps more accurately. Another key strategy is to prioritize survival over coin collection, especially at higher levels of difficulty.
Don’t be overly fixated on collecting every single coin. Sometimes, a safe jump is more valuable than a risky maneuver for a few coins. Focus on maintaining a consistent flow and avoiding collisions. Also, practice makes perfect. The more you play, the better you’ll become at judging distances and reacting to the changing traffic conditions. This muscle memory will become invaluable as the game’s speed increases.
Utilizing Power-Ups and Upgrades
Many versions of the chicken road game incorporate power-ups and upgrade systems, significantly impacting your ability to survive and score highly. These are often purchased using the coins collected during gameplay. Common power-ups might include temporary invincibility, slowing down time, or attracting coins from a distance. Upgrades can permanently improve the chicken’s abilities, such as increasing jump height or reducing the time it takes to recover from a near miss.
Carefully consider which power-ups and upgrades to invest in. Prioritizing upgrades that enhance your core abilities – jumping and speed – is generally more effective than relying solely on temporary power-ups. Experiment with different combinations to find what works best for your playing style. A well-planned upgrade path can dramatically extend your gameplay and allow you to achieve significantly higher scores.
